#300b53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#300b53 is composed of 18.8% red, 4.3%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.2%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 270.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 18.4%. #300b53 color hex could be obtained by blending #6016a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#300b53 color description : Very dark violet.
#300b53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#300b53 has RGB values of R:48, G:11,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3148627.

Shades and Tints of #300b53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020e is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#300b53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2c32 is the less saturated color, while #30005e is the most saturated one.
